USA Properties Fund, Irvine Co. Break Ground On 338 Tustin Apartments: The Los Angeles Deal Sheet
USA Properties Fund and Irvine Co. began construction on Terracina at Tustin Legacy, a 338-unit affordable apartment complex in a 1,600-acre master-planned development transforming a former Marine Corps Air Station in Tustin.

The Terracina at Tustin will feature one- to three-bedroom apartments as well as a clubhouse, swimming pool and parking garage. Construction is expected to be complete in mid-2029, with leasing and some move-ins in the second half of 2028.
PEOPLE
Hackman Capital Partners hired David Felman as chief financial officer. Felman will lead Hackman Capital Partners’ finance functions, guide financial strategy and work alongside the executive team.
Felman has more than 20 years of experience in financial operations, corporate finance, capital markets, real estate and private equity. He most recently served as the chief financial officer of investment platform Anderson Holdings.
SALES
Positive Investments sold Terramonte at Foothill, a 138-unit multifamily complex in Pomona, for $36.7M, or just under $266K per unit.
Institutional Property Advisors’ Kevin Green, Chris Zorbas, Joseph Grabiec, Alexander Garcia Jr. and Greg Harris represented the seller, Positive Investments, and procured the buyer, Sack Capital Partners.
The Olson Co. bought an 8-acre office campus in Monterey Park for an office-to-residential conversion project. The two-building campus measures about 120K SF. The Olson Co. has filed plans to build 159 townhomes on the site, according to Urbanize LA. The Olson Co. paid approximately $24.9M for the property at 601 Potrero Grande Drive and 2100 Saturn St.
NAI Capital Commercial’s Ryan Campbell represented the buyer. JLL’s Andrew Harper, Jeff Bramson and Will Poulsen represented the undisclosed seller.
Colliers announced the $8.5M sale of a multifamily complex located at 1775 Beloit Ave. in West Los Angeles. Colliers Vice Chair Kitty Wallace represented both the buyer, UCLA Housing Group, and seller, Enterprise Bank.
The sale was completed through a court-appointed receivership process.
Constructed in 2023, the seven-story, coliving property is roughly 18K SF with 16 residential units totaling 48 beds. The transaction closed at $531K per unit, or approximately $472 per SF.
Shopoff Realty Investments sold the proposed 1-acre Newport Beach condo development, Park Palm, to Shea Homes. The property is part of the firm’s master-planned community, Uptown Newport Village, and is entitled for 23 townhomes. Construction for Park Palm is expected to begin in 2027, with completion expected before the end of 2029.
The sale price was not disclosed. Shopoff bought the 25-acre Uptown Newport Village site in December 2010 for $23.5M.
LEASES
Cactus Fabrication, a production fabrication company serving the entertainment industry, signed a 10-year lease agreement for a roughly 35K SF industrial property in Rancho Dominguez. The property at 2945 E. Maria St. will serve as the West Coast operations hub for Cactus. Total consideration of the lease is $6.4M, according to DAUM Commercial Real Estate Services, which represented the landlord, Crown Associates Realty Inc.
